About the Role
The Women's Health Service is seeking a Clinical Nurse Specialist for Endometriosis. This role provides specialist nursing care and expertise in direct care delivery for the management of patients suffering from Endometriosis. Working closely alongside gynaecologists, surgeons and allied health services, this is an advanced practice role where you will provide evidence-based, nurse-led solutions to meet patient demand for endometriosis treatment and management.

About you
To be successful in this role, you must be a Registered Nurse in New Zealand, with a current practicing certificate. You will have a post graduate diploma in specialty practice, and will be working towards/have achieved your Master's degree. You will have at least 5 years experience in women's health or surgery.
You will have demonstrable leadership abilities within the health sector, a reputation for excellence in specialty practice, and a passion for improving service delivery.
